Orange Corrugated Tubing Versatility and Applications


Orange corrugated tubing is a highly versatile and widely used material in various industries. Characterized by its distinct orange hue, this tubing is commonly made from high-density polyethylene (HDPE) or similar materials, making it not just visually striking but also durable and flexible. Its unique properties make it an ideal choice for a range of applications, including electrical, automotive, and construction sectors.


One of the primary uses of orange corrugated tubing is for the protection of electrical cables. The tubing acts as a robust barrier, safeguarding wires from abrasion, moisture, and other environmental factors. The corrugated design allows for greater flexibility and movement, making it easier to navigate tight spaces and sharp bends. Additionally, orange is often chosen for its high visibility, which helps identify and differentiate electrical conduits in complex installations, thereby enhancing safety and reducing the risk of accidental damage.


In the automotive industry, orange corrugated tubing plays a crucial role in protecting various wiring systems. It is used to encase and safeguard essential electrical components, shielding them from heat, chemicals, and mechanical wear. The flexibility of the tubing allows it to adapt to the movement and vibrations associated with a vehicle's operation while maintaining the integrity of the internal wiring. The use of orange tubing in automotive applications ensures that technicians can easily identify cable pathways and understand the layout of electrical systems during maintenance or repairs.

In the construction sector, orange corrugated tubing is also prevalent, particularly in underground installations. It is often utilized for conduit systems that house electrical and communication cables. Its lightweight yet durable construction facilitates easier handling and installation, making it a preferred choice for electricians and contractors. The corrugated shape provides increased resistance against crushing and impacts, ensuring that the enclosed cables remain protected even in challenging environments. The high visibility of orange tubing also aids in avoiding accidental damage during construction activities.
